DSS Releases Nura Idri, Wrongfully Arrested Over Boko Haram

The Department of State Services (DSS), under the direction of Oluwatosin Adeola Ajayi, ordered the immediate release of Nura Idri, who was wrongfully linked to Boko Haram terrorism. Following a thorough review by the DSS investigation panel, it was determined that there was no basis for the charges against Idri.
As part of the compensation for his wrongful detention, he received ₦3 million to assist in restarting his life. Upon his release, Nura expressed gratitude towards the DSS for their kind treatment and support.
His father, Yusuf Idri, also thanked the agency for their generosity. The DSS has committed to providing psychological and medical support to wrongfully detained individuals and aims to uphold citizens' rights while ensuring national security.
This release is part of an internal review exercise initiated by the DSS to reassess prolonged detention cases and prevent wrongful detentions in the future.
